Carlos Andres Perez's Obituary
Carlos Andres Perez
August 3, 1962 – November 4, 2024
Carlos was born on August 3, 1962, in Marianao, Cuba. At just three years old, he moved with his family to New Jersey before eventually settling in Miami, where he was surrounded by a large and loving extended family, all living nearby in a close-knit community in Sweetwater.
Carlos is survived by his three daughters, Lauren, Katrina, and Samantha Perez, his four sisters, Juana Baez, Mercy Edinger, Adelfa Perez, Maria Perez, his partner, Maria Christina, and his six beloved nieces and nephews. He was predeceased by his parents, Carlos and Mercedes Perez.
In his youth, Carlos was an accomplished black belt in martial arts, inspired by his hero Bruce Lee, and kept an active spirit throughout his life. Carlos was a dedicated fan of the Miami Dolphins, the Miami Heat, and the Miami Hurricanes, cheering on his teams with pride. He was also an avid music lover, with an enormous collection of records and cassettes to his name.
He found peace at the beach, where he could often be found with just a beach chair, speaker and cooler nearby. He cherished simple pleasures: cruising the neighborhoods of Miami Beach, Neapolitan ice cream at the end of a long day, and spending time with his two beloved cats, Charlie and Kevin.
Carlos leaves behind cherished memories with his three daughters—afternoons spent launching them off his shoulders into the pool, teaching them how to ride bikes, taking them to Sports Grill to watch the game, and joining them on school field trips. Many holidays were filled with beach vacations across Florida, whitewater rafting in the mountains of Georgia and road-tripping to Disney World.
Carlos also leaves behind his beloved Ticket Clinic family, where he dedicated 15 years with colleagues who felt like family.
Goofy and full of jokes, Carlos brought laughter wherever he went, even in his crankiness. He will be remembered for his warmth, his humor, and the quirks that made him so beloved by family and friends.
